Italian solid silver tray with cloche, early XX century
Height x width x depth: 17 x 50 x 36 cm. Weight: 2560 g
Both the profile of the tray and the rim of the cloche are defined by a rich embossed frame featuring volutes, foliage and rocaille motifs. On the front of the dome stands out a large and intricately detailed coat of arms, divided into four quarters (depicting three lilies, a crown, a sailing ship and a landscape), framed by plant-shaped volutes finely engraved with a burin. The top of the lid is surmounted by a handle shaped with floral motifs and volutes.
Hallmarked with unidentified marks and ‘Marzari Trieste’.
